Meanwhile, the lack of a motive is playing a role in why authorities generally are not calling him a "terrorist," reports NBC News.

By federal definition, a terrorist has a political motive, and Conditt appears to have lacked one. Critics, however, see a double standard at play because Conditt is white.

The explosions went on for weeks, ending on March 21, 2018 when the bomber detonated an explosive in his car as police closed in on him. For months afterwards, the FBI combed through evidence searching for reasons why 23-year-old Mark Anthony Conditt planted bombs across the city, killing two and injuring several others at random. The bomber did not have any previous run-ins with police and investigators could not find an event that triggered the terror.

The decision comes one year after ProPublica, The Texas Tribune and Military Times published an investigation exposing how hundreds of soldiers charged with violent crimes were administratively discharged instead of facing a court martial.

Instead, the newly created Office of Special Trial Counsel, a group of military attorneys who specialize in handling cases involving violent crimes, must also approve the decision. The new rule will apply only to cases that fall under the purview of the Office of Special Trial Counsel, including sexual assault, domestic violence, child abuse, kidnapping and murder. In 2021, Congress authorized creation of the new legal office — one for each military branch except the U. As of December, attorneys with this special office, and not commanders, now decide whether to prosecute cases related to those serious offenses. Army officials told the news organizations that the change in discharge authority was made in response to the creation of the Office of Special Trial Counsel. As far back as 1978, a federal watchdog agency called for the U. Department of Defense to end its policy of allowing service members accused of crimes to leave the military to avoid going to court.

Armed forces leaders continued the practice anyway. Last year, ProPublica, the Tribune and Military Times found that more than half of the 900 soldiers who were allowed to leave the Army in the previous decade rather than go to trial had been accused of violent crimes, including sexual assault and domestic violence, according to an analysis of roughly 8,000 Army courts-martial cases that reached arraignment. These soldiers had to acknowledge that they committed an offense that could be punishable under military law but did not have to admit guilt to a specific crime or face any other consequences that can come with a conviction, like registering as a sex offender. Unabomber Theodore Kaczynski is serving a life sentence in the US Image: A parcel bomb exploded at a FedEx building in Schertz, Texas, on Tuesday Image: Anthony House, 39, and Draylen Mason, 17, have been killed by the Austin bomber Image: FBI Parcel containing nails and shrapnel explodes in FedEx building in Texas as police in Austin probe serial bombings Little is known about the background of the Austin killer, who has targeted three different neighbourhoods, or why the bombing campaign is being carried out. Many of the victims were minorities, and that has fuelled theories that the attacks were racially motivated. But police do not know if the victims were targeted and there is no known suspect or motive. The first bombing on March 2 killed Anthony House, a 39-year-old black man, as he handled a box left on his front porch.

A few hours later, a third bombing injured a 75-year-old Hispanic woman when she picked up a package left outside her home. Those powerful devices were similar to each other and were all packed in cardboard packages that were delivered at night, but not by the US Postal Service or a delivery firm. A package left at the side of the road may have been triggered by a tripwire.

Conditt entered a FedEx store and shipped one of the parcels using an alias. In his recording, he says he realised that this was a mistake, since it allowed surveillance cameras to see him as well as the license plate of his car parked outside. He reported said that "I wish I were sorry but I am not. The series of bombings killed two people and injured at least five others.

The chief said SWAT officers banged on his window and within seconds he had detonated a bomb inside his vehicle, blasting the officers backward before one fired his gun at Conditt. Law enforcement officials did not immediately say whether Conditt acted alone in the five bombings in the Texas capital and suburban San Antonio. Fred Milanowski, of the US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ives, said investigators were confident that "the same person built each one of these devices.
